#PremierLeague: Unai Emery extends contract with Aston Villa

Date:

Unai Emery has signed a five-year contract extension with Aston Villa after a historic 2023–24 Premier League season.

The former Arsenal manager led Villa to the 2024–25 UEFA Champions League by finishing fourth in the league standings.

Emery, 52, finished seventh with Midland Club in the 2022–23 season, and it has been improvement after improvement.

The Spaniard also led the club to the semifinals of the UEFA Conference League, crashing out to Olympiacos in Greece.

“I am very happy to take this step and the responsibility of leading this club,” said Emery.

“There’s a great chemistry in Aston Villa. And the element of the fans’ support also makes the difference to feel like home.

“We are really excited to continue this journey with no limits to our dreams,” he added.
